GoHighLevel SMS Pricing 2026: Complete Cost Breakdown Per Message and Segment
GoHighLevel SMS Pricing (2026)
GoHighLevel's SMS costs range from $0.0075 to $0.08+ per segment globally. Your final rate depends on where you're sending messages, which mobile carrier handles delivery, and how your message is formatted.
The system bills based on segments rather than whole messages. This means your texting expenses can increase based on message length, character type, and destination.

How GoHighLevel SMS Billing Functions
GoHighLevel routes messages through Twilio's network, which creates flexible pricing instead of set rates.
Twilio's pricing documentation shows that SMS costs change based on:
destination country
carrier routing and delivery paths
message type (SMS vs MMS)
character encoding (GSM-7 vs Unicode/UCS-2)
This is why GoHighLevel SMS pricing varies between different locations.
GoHighLevel SMS Rates by Country
Message costs per segment vary across different regions:
Region
Estimated Rate per SMS Segment
United States
$0.0075 - $0.01
Canada
$0.01 - $0.015
United Kingdom
$0.04 - $0.06
Europe (average)
$0.03 - $0.06
Australia
$0.05 - $0.07
India
$0.02 - $0.05
Middle East
$0.03 - $0.08
These are estimated ranges. Your actual GoHighLevel SMS costs will depend on specific carrier deals and routing quality.
Rates may shift slightly due to carrier updates and local rule changes.
Understanding Segment-Based Pricing in GoHighLevel
How messages get divided into segments directly impacts your GoHighLevel text costs.
SMS Segment Character Limits
GSM-7 encoding supports up to 160 characters
Unicode (UCS-2 encoding) supports up to 70 characters
Technical Details (Important)
Unicode (UCS-2) encoding cuts available characters and increases segment usage, which raises your cost per message compared to GSM-7 encoded texts.
Messages longer than one segment use linked SMS with UDH (User Data Header), which reduces characters per segment. Multi-part messages don't scale evenly (2 segments don't give exactly 320 characters).
Practical Example
150 characters = 1 segment
220 characters = 2 segments
Unicode messages split into segments faster
Each segment gets billed separately, increasing your total SMS costs.
Practical Cost Example: SMS Pricing Calculations
Sending 5,000 SMS messages with:
average message length of 180 characters
2 segments per message
Total cost calculation:
5,000 messages × 2 segments × regional rate = total SMS cost
Minor changes in message length or encoding can significantly raise your GoHighLevel SMS expenses.
Global Factors Affecting GoHighLevel SMS Costs
Several variables impact your actual text messaging costs in GoHighLevel:
Message Length
Longer messages need more segments.
Unicode and International Content
Languages like Arabic, Urdu, and emoji use reduce character limits and increase costs.
MMS Usage
Media messages cost much more than regular SMS.
Location and Carrier
Different phone networks use different pricing models.
Compliance and Regulations
US needs A2P 10DLC
India needs DLT registration
UK has sender ID rules
EU follows GDPR-related policies
These requirements can create additional costs.
